JUST IN: Italian Club Sack Mourinho, Announces Ex Captain As New Coach

Former Chelsea coach, Jose Mourinho, had been at the helm of the Serie A club, Roma since the summer of 2021 and guided them to the Europa Conference League title in 2022 and the Europa League final the following season.

However, having struggled domestically and presently siting in the ninth position in the Italian top-flight, plus the Sunday’s 3-1 loss at Milan as their third defeat in five league games and has proved to be Mourinho’s final match as a boss at the Giallorossi club.
The 60 years old coach Mourinho has been sacked after two-and-a-half years in charge at Roma, with Daniele De Rossi named as his replacement.
